Java,安全,数字签名的工作原理及加解密、签名和验签

数字签名的工作原理1、Alice(密码学中常用A到Z开头的人名代替甲乙丙丁等,字母越靠后出现频率越低)生成一对密钥,一个是sk(signing key),是非公开的;另一个是vk(verification key),是公开的。

图解 | 深入理解高性能网络开发路上的绊脚石 – 同步阻塞网络 IO

在网络开发模型中,有一种非常易于开发同学使用的方式,那就是同步阻塞的网络 IO。例如我们想请求服务器上的一段数据,那么 C 语言的一段代码 demo 大概是下面这样:但是在高并发的服务器开发中,这种网络 IO 的性能奇差。

深入理解高性能网络开发路上的绊脚石 – 同步阻塞网络 IO

linux服务器开发相关视频解析:linux下的epoll实战揭秘——支撑亿级IO的底层基石90分钟搞懂多线程网络编程模型在网络开发模型中,有一种非常易于开发同学使用的方式,那就是同步阻塞的网络 IO。

GO语言实现 一 栈和队列

线性表中,栈和队列是非常重要的两种数据结构,本文将就这两种数据结构进行 golang语言实现。我们维护两个栈,一个是值栈,一个是操作栈,我们在读取表达式的时候采取如下的策略:如果遇到 ”,我们从值栈中取出两个值 n1和 n2,在操作栈中,我们取出一个操作符 op。

网站地图